ACCA (the Association of Chartered Certified Accountants), the global professional body for professional accountants, along with the Institute of Directors (IOD), India, an apex association of Corporate Directors in India, have jointly launched a report, titled ‘Rethinking Risk for the Future – An India Perspective.’ The research for this report has revealed views from a…
Tag: GRC
MetricStream Hires New Global Leader
by
•MetricStream, provider of governance, risk, and compliance (GRC), and integrated risk management products and solutions, has announced Michael Johnson as SVP of Channel and Alliances. This is part of the growth strategy of the company. Michael is a sales leader who comes to MetricStream from ITA Group, a global partner to Fortune 1000 technology companies where he…